Halanay inequality
Theorem in Mathematics From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Halanay inequality is a comparison theorem for differential equations with delay.[1] This inequality and its generalizations have been applied to analyze the stability of delayed differential equations, and in particular, the stability of industrial processes with dead-time[2] and delayed neural networks.[3][4]
